Surface Mounting Solutions

Surface mounting brackets attach directly to finished walls, concrete, or steel without requiring access to the panel rear. These brackets suit retrofit projects where studs or rails are not available and where aesthetic continuity is important.

Through-Clamp Installation for Steel Stud

Through-clamp brackets engage steel stud tracks and provide high pull-out resistance for taller signs and fascia boards. This method supports heavier loads and allows adjustment along the track for panel alignment during installation.

Adjustable Sign Brackets

Adjustable brackets accommodate varying panel thicknesses and dimensional tolerances in existing substrates. Features such as vertical and horizontal adjustment simplify alignment for multi-panel assemblies and reduce rework on uneven walls.

Material, Finish, and Compliance

Product selections include stainless steel, coated carbon steel, and aluminum options with UV-stable finishes for exterior exposure. Look for load test certifications, corrosion resistance ratings, and code-compliant mounting patterns to ensure long-term performance in commercial environments.

  • Match bracket family to substrate type and expected load.
  • Verify panel thickness compatibility with clamp or mounting inserts.
  • Confirm load ratings and deflection limits for oversized signs.
  • Select corrosion-resistant finishes for exterior or high-humidity locations.
  • Follow manufacturer spacing and torque specifications for anchors.
